Labarsingi Population - Gajapati, Orissa
Labarsingi is a medium size village located in Mohana Block of Gajapati district, Orissa with total 224 families residing. The Labarsingi village has population of 1093 of which 556 are males while 537 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Labarsingi village population of children with age 0-6 is 165 which makes up 15.10 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Labarsingi village is 966 which is lower than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Labarsingi as per census is 1230, higher than Orissa average of 941.
Labarsingi village has lower liter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Labarsingi village was 59.05 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Labarsingi Male literacy stands at 67.01 % while female literacy rate was 50.45 %.

Labarsingi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 224 | - | - |
Population | 1,093 | 556 | 537 |
Child (0-6) | 165 | 74 | 91 |
Schedule Caste | 137 | 58 | 79 |
Schedule Tribe | 250 | 137 | 113 |
Literacy | 59.05 % | 67.01 % | 50.45 % |
Total Workers | 672 | 344 | 328 |
Main Worker | 531 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 141 | 43 | 98 |
